Kim Kang-min (Korean: 김강민; Hanja: 金江珉; Korean pronunciation: [ȴu.çʌndʑin]; born September 13, 1982) is a former South Korean outfielder who played for the SSG Landers(formerly the SK Wyverns), and Hanwha Eagles in the KBO League.
